Distribuzione di Prometheus su EKS Kubernetes Cluster
- Passaggio 1: configura kubectl. ...
- Passaggio 2: installa Kubernetes Metrics Server. ...
- Passaggio 3: installa Helm. ...
- Passaggio 4: distribuzione di Prometheus su EKS Kubernetes Cluster. ...
- Passaggio 4: accedi a Prometheus su EKS Kubernetes Cluster.
- Come distribuisci Prometheus su EKS?
- Come posso monitorare Kubernetes con Prometheus?
- Come si monitorano i cluster Kubernetes con Prometheus e Grafana?
- In che modo Prometheus si integra con AWS?
- Che cos'è AWS Prometheus?
- Come distribuisci Grafana su Kubernetes?
- Cosa puoi monitorare con Prometheus?
- Cosa posso monitorare con Kubernetes?
- Come ottengo le metriche di Prometheus?
- Che cosa sono Prometeo e Grafana in Kubernetes?
- Come funziona Prometeo?
- Come colleghi Prometeo a Grafana?
Come distribuisci Prometheus su EKS?
Per schierare Prometheus usando Helm
- Crea uno spazio dei nomi Prometheus. ...
- Distribuisci Prometeo. ...
- Verificare che tutti i pod nello spazio dei nomi prometheus siano nello stato PRONTO. ...
- Usa kubectl per eseguire il port forwarding della console Prometheus sul tuo computer locale. ...
- Puntare un browser Web su localhost: 9090 per visualizzare la console Prometheus.
Come posso monitorare Kubernetes con Prometheus?
Come monitorare Kubernetes con Prometheus
- Regole globali di scraping.
- Scrape Node.
- Raschiare APIServer.
- Scrape Pods for Kubernetes Services (esclusi i server API)
- Ruolo pod.
- Configurare ReplicaSet.
- Definisci nodePort.
Come si monitorano i cluster Kubernetes con Prometheus e Grafana?
Distribuisci Prometeo & Grafana per monitorare il cluster
- Passaggio 1: creazione dello spazio dei nomi del monitor. Per prima cosa creeremo uno spazio dei nomi e seguiremo le buone pratiche. ...
- Passaggio 2: installazione di Prometheus Operator. ...
- Passaggio 3: configurare Grafana Dashboard. ...
- Passaggio 4: ottenere l'elenco delle metriche da monitorare.
In che modo Prometheus si integra con AWS?
Distribuzione dell'app e dell'agente CloudWatch Prometheus
In primo luogo, spingere l'immagine del contenitore Docker dell'ASP.NET Core compilata in precedenza in un registro contenitori di tua scelta. Quindi, sostituire <YOUR_CONTAINER_REPO> nella distribuzione. yaml con il valore del repository contenitore in cui hai pubblicato l'immagine.
Che cos'è AWS Prometheus?
Amazon Managed Service for Prometheus (AMP) è un servizio di monitoraggio compatibile con Prometheus che semplifica il monitoraggio delle applicazioni containerizzate su larga scala. Il progetto Prometheus di Cloud Native Computing Foundation è una popolare soluzione open source di monitoraggio e avviso ottimizzata per ambienti container.
Come distribuisci Grafana su Kubernetes?
Distribuisci Grafana su Kubernetes
- Passaggio 1: creare un file denominato grafana-datasource-config.yaml vi grafana-datasource-config.yaml. ...
- Passaggio 2: creare la mappa di configurazione utilizzando il seguente comando. ...
- Passaggio 3: creare un file denominato deployment.distribuzione di yaml vi.yaml. ...
- Passaggio 4: creare la distribuzione kubectl create -f deployment.yaml.
Cosa puoi monitorare con Prometheus?
Utilizzando Prometheus, è possibile monitorare le metriche dell'applicazione come il throughput (TPS) e i tempi di risposta del generatore di carico Kafka (produttore Kafka), del consumatore Kafka e del client Cassandra. Il programma di esportazione dei nodi può essere utilizzato per il monitoraggio dell'hardware host e delle metriche del kernel.
Cosa posso monitorare con Kubernetes?
Ecco gli strumenti di monitoraggio open source più popolari e affidabili tra cui puoi scegliere quando lavori con Kubernetes.
- Kubelet. ...
- Container Advisor (cAdvisor) ...
- Metriche dello stato di Kube. ...
- Dashboard Kubernetes. ...
- Prometeo. ...
- Jaeger. ...
- Kubewatch. ...
- Portata del tessuto.
Come ottengo le metriche di Prometheus?
Prometheus si aspetta che le metriche siano disponibili sugli obiettivi su un percorso di / metrics . Quindi questo lavoro predefinito esegue lo scraping tramite l'URL: http: // localhost: 9090 / metrics. I dati delle serie temporali restituiti descriveranno in dettaglio lo stato e le prestazioni del server Prometheus.
Che cosa sono Prometeo e Grafana in Kubernetes?
Prometheus e Grafana rendono estremamente facile monitorare praticamente qualsiasi metrica nel tuo cluster Kubernetes. In questo articolo mostrerò come aggiungere il monitoraggio per tutti i nodi nel tuo cluster.
Come funziona Prometeo?
Prometheus raccoglie le metriche dai lavori strumentati, direttamente o tramite un gateway push intermedio per lavori di breve durata. Memorizza localmente tutti i campioni raschiati ed esegue regole su questi dati per aggregare e registrare nuove serie temporali dai dati esistenti o generare avvisi.
Come colleghi Prometeo a Grafana?
Installa Grafana sulla nostra istanza che interroga il nostro server Prometheus.
...
Installazione di Grafana
- Fare clic sul logo Grafana per aprire la barra laterale.
- Fare clic su "Origini dati" nella barra laterale.
- Scegli "Aggiungi nuovo".
- Seleziona "Prometeo" come origine dati.
- Fare clic su "Aggiungi" per testare la connessione e salvare la nuova origine dati.